Mavin Records boss, Don Jazzy has revealed plans to expand and properly structure the music label.
In his New Year message, the super producer said the record label will be employing the services of Talent and Catalog Management professionals, Content Developers, Retail, Sales and Fashion, Licensing specialist, Touring and Logistics specialist, Social Media Analysts among others.
The message said in part, “A Mavin is someone who has exceptional talent and skill in their field. As part of our 2016 goals, we decided to increase our workforce to 50, which we surpassed by a slight margin as we have a workforce of 55.
“As you all know, the Entertainment Business is not complete without those who are skilled in the Business, therefore we are seeking to expand our work-force to 120 team in 2017 considering our forthcoming projects.
We wait to see how this new development will affect Mavin Records and if it will have any impact in the Nigerian music industry.
Mavin Records is a revamped Nigerian-based record label founded by recording artist and record producer Don Jazzy on 8 May, 2012.
The record label, houses some of Nigeria’s biggest music names today. They include Tiwa Savage, Dr SID, D’Prince, Di’Ja, Reekado Banks and Iyanya
